发明名称 Distributed Airborne Beamforming System
摘要 A distributed beamforming communication system including independent aerial nodes forming an antenna array is described. Described herein is a distributed beamforming array which utilizes independent aerial relay nodes or platforms (i.e. no strict control of relay node position, no communication between the relay nodes, and no coordinated transmission among the relay nodes) to form a distributed beamforming antenna.

主权项 1. A system comprising: two or more aerial relay nodes, at least one of which can move independently of the other aerial relay nodes; a receiver to receive a transmission from each of the two or more aerial relay nodes and convert the transmission to a digital representation of each transmission at an output thereof, wherein the transmission comprises at least a data message and a reference signature for calculation of the desired beamforming weights; and an adaptive beamforming processor, coupled to the output of said receiver, said adaptive beamforming processor configured to: receive the digital representation of each transmission including a signature sequence for calculation of the desired beamforming weights from each of the two or more aerial relay nodes;generate a set of beamforming weights for the signals received from two or more aerial relay nodes where said weights are based on the reference signature signal characteristics received from each respective aerial relay node wherein the set of weights compensates for at least physical spacing, relative motion, and signal timing;apply the weights to the respective transmission received from the respective relay node to form a signal received from an effective desired beampattern; andprocess the signal received through the desired beamformer.
